Transaction 8efcea833c2134768afa822a4b1743fc55dc36cd7bcb9d42d803d087c1de90c3
1 Input
1 Output
-
8efcea833c2134768afa822a4b1743fc55dc36cd7bcb9d42d803d087c1de90c3:0
- value
- 7723302
- script pubkey
- OP_0 OP_PUSHBYTES_20 e42e75ce872448042065b28c0091d4a67e53b642
- address
- bc1qush8tn58y3yqggr9k2xqpyw55el98djzkhgxwk